New Crackle Vase

Provocative and ornamental, the new Crackle Vase Collection exists within a fine line between strength and fragility. At first glance, ADesignStudio’s custom crackle glass finish appears as if it is already fractured and it is a wonder that it holds together at all. JAM FACTORY LUMINOUS EXHIBITION

LUMINOUS is a group exhibition that features pendant lighting by eight different contemporary Australian artists, makers and designers. The exhibition showcases innovative and dynamic designs that have been conceived across a range of different materials, forms and processes. Greenway finalist in LAMP competition

PROJECT: LAMP COMPETITION   DESIGN: ADESIGNSTUDIO   FIXTURE: GREENWAY PUTER CUSTOM   LOCATION: VANCOUVER, CANADA   PHOTOGRAPHER: Michael Young   YEAR: 2016   Greenway was a finalist in the international LAMP competition 2016 in the Emerging category, one of 132 submissions received from 27 countries. “Super Fresh” debut in Milan

The Local Design exhibition, featuring ADesignStudio’s Eon and LightGarden ranges, has been called “super, super fresh” by Milan television channel Corriere TV. The exhibition, curated by Emma Elizabeth and Tom Fereday, represented a collection of Australian design for the first time, at the world’s biggest international design event in April this year.
